Modifying the Bingo Game: Shopping Spree Challenge
For example, a newspaper in Iowa wanted to run a “non-Bingo” Bingo promotion to avoid conflicting with some local regulations. So we put our heads together and came up with the Shopping Spree Challenge. Instead of printing numbers on each square, we printed the names of products offered by local sponsors. The newspaper published a featured product each day instead of a call number and players marked off the products as they appeared in the paper just as they would have marked off a call number. Winning cards still had either a diagonal, vertical, or horizontal cover and then the Grand Prize winning card was the one with every product covered.
The Shopping Spree Challenge also allowed the newspaper to sell small blocks that featured their sponsors’ products – a real hit with their advertisers! Each sponsor could choose the level of sponsorship they were comfortable with. Whatever level they chose, they were guaranteed to receive great publicity for their products!
Modifying the Bingo Game: Pizza Challenge
This interesting take on Bingo turned out to be, well, not a whole lot like Bingo at all! The Pizza Challenge involved cards with printed grids, and each grid included five rows and five columns – a lot like Bingo, but wait! Instead of random numbers, some squares included requirements for the game player to complete in order to mark off that particular square.
For example, one square instructed the players to “like” the pizza shop’s Facebook page, while another square required the player to spend a certain amount of money at the restaurant. Each row on the game card offered a different prize – like a free buffet lunch, for example – if each square in the row was covered.
Modifying the Bingo Game: Location, Location, Location!
One newspaper came to BestBingoPromo.com and asked if we could provide a fun game that somehow tied into March Madness. We thought that was a terrific idea, and it got us all thinking about other unique ways we could switch up the traditional Bingo game.
After a little research, we discovered that the newspaper’s hometown was known as the Christmas Tree Capital of the World, and it also happened to be the birthplace of Jimmy Stewart. With these two facts in mind, we began brainstorming ways to incorporate the town’s history into the Bingo game and came up with a terrific idea. Instead of numbers, we could use images from historical spots around town along with characters from the movie “It’s a Wonderful Life” to represent the numbers in each square. Even though the game would be played just like traditional Bingo, the card could be unique to the newspaper’s location, which adds a little something special to the promotion.
